Zayed bin Sultan Al Nahyan Charitable and Humanitarian Foundation

The foundation was established in 1992 by Sheikh Zayed bin Sultan Al Nahyan. Its initial endowment of $1 billion supports long-term humanitarian programs. Sheikh Nahyan bin Zayed Al Nahyan serves as chairman while Sheikh Omar bin Zayed Al Nahyan acts as vice chairman. The foundation allocates across healthcare, education, and infrastructure. Confirmed projects include the Zayed Mother and Child Hospital in Sanaa, the Zayed Center for Research into Rare Diseases in Children in London, and a network of 238 water wells spanning Niger, Sudan, and Mali. It also holds limited partnership interests in Ardian private equity funds. Geographic reach covers the Middle East, South Asia, Africa, and Europe. Structures include direct ownership of facilities and co-financing with local governments. The organization maintains roughly 20 named physical assets valued in the tens of millions. In 2024 it became part of the newly formed Erth Zayed Philanthropies umbrella. April 2025: Sponsored the Dubai International Humanitarian Aid & Development Conference. Oversight is provided by the Abu Dhabi Accountability Authority. Governance rests with a board drawn from the Al Nahyan family and appointed directors. The structure separates day-to-day project execution from the endowment vehicle, allowing the foundation to act as both grant maker and direct asset owner.

Frequently asked questions

Who runs investment decisions at the foundation?

Sheikh Nahyan bin Zayed Al Nahyan chairs the board. Day-to-day operations fall to Director General Dr. Mohamed Ateeq Al Falahi. External managers such as Ardian handle selected private equity allocations.

Does the foundation participate in fund commitments or only direct deals?

It maintains limited partnership interests in Ardian funds while also owning physical assets directly. Examples include hospitals in Yemen and Pakistan and the Zayed Center in London.

Where does the underlying wealth come from?

The endowment originated from Sheikh Zayed bin Sultan Al Nahyan. The foundation reports all figures in USD and maintains an AED operating account as a UAE entity.

How is the foundation related to Erth Zayed Philanthropies?

Erth Zayed Philanthropies was established in 2024 as the umbrella entity. It consolidates the Zayed foundation with other UAE philanthropic vehicles under a single governance structure.

What investment stages does the foundation target through external managers?

Through Ardian it gains exposure to buyout, secondaries, and venture strategies. Direct activity focuses on completed facilities rather than early-stage company formation.

Which regions receive the largest share of capital?

Projects are documented in the UAE, Yemen, Pakistan, Bangladesh, Morocco, the Comoros, the UK, Sweden, and multiple African countries. No single-country allocation percentages are published.

Does the foundation maintain an ESG or impact policy?

It operates under a Sustainable Giving framework aligned with UN Sustainable Development Goals. Allocations target healthcare, education, and water access without additional formal ESG reporting.
